the developers
/ðə dɪˈveləpərz/
EN
Plural noun referring to people or teams that create, design, and build software applications, websites, or other technological products, or people that develop land or ideas.
The developers launched a new version of the mobile app this week.
Etymology
Derived from the verb 'develop', which entered English in the 17th century from French 'développer', combining the prefix 'des-' (undoing) and Old French 'veloper' (to wrap). The agent noun 'developer' formed in the early 18th century, with the plural 'developers' following standard English pluralization rules.
